The GPU is operating at a frequency of 200MHz, memory is running at 183MHz. Being a single-slot card, the NVIDIA Quadro2 MXR does not require any additional power connector, its power draw is not exactly known. Display outputs include: 1x VGA. Quadro2 MXR is connected to the rest of the system using an AGP 4x interface.
